Skokie Sports Park is home to one of the top 50 golf ranges in America, featuring TrackMan golf launch monitors, grass tees, and an automatic tee-up system. The park also features The Bunker, an indoor golf simulator for authentic indoor practice.

Sports Park offers 27 holes of adventure mini-golf, as well as batting cages with a wide variety of speeds. The amenities are perfect for fully customizable parties and events.

Golf Range with TrackMan

Rated one of the top 50 golf ranges in America, Sports Park features a year-round, two-tier, 40 station range with an automatic tee-up system –– and TrackMan! Golfers can purchase a range card at the club house and swing away! Golfers have the option to buy a bucket of balls and use the open-air hitting stations or hit at one of our new grass tee stations. 

TrackMan

TrackMan uses cutting-edge technology to deliver real-time tracking of every shot, providing players with a multitude of data and interactive features including:

Practice features
Ideal for solo practice, Lessons, and data driven improvement. Improve your game with actionable feedback.

  • Ball data: Track key metrics like carry distance, total distance, ball speed, launch angle, height, and more.
  • Shot grouping & dispersion: Understand consistency with visual shot patterns.
  • Club selection: Practice with any club and get specific data for each.
  • Personalization: Create a player profile and save session data via the TrackMan Golf app, accessible on mobile devices.
  • Target practice: Aim at various virtual targets and see how close you land.

Course Play
Ideal for a player to utilize realistic golf course play when you can’t be on a real course.  Simulate playing world-renowned golf courses from the comfort of your driving range bay.

  • Virtual golf experience: Play real-life courses like St Andrews, Pebble Beach, and others using your real shots on the range.
  • Single or multiplayer: Play alone or with friends.
  • Hole-by-hole play: Choose full rounds or specific holes.
  • Adjustable conditions: Change weather, pin positions, and tee boxes.

Adventure (Mini) Golf

At the 18-hole Traveler's Quest, visit some of the world's most iconic places, from the Eiffel Tower to Antarctica to the Willis Tower, all the while playing through several water features and a waterfall. 

Kids Quest offers a 9-hole course that is perfect for little ones.

Force Analysis Session
Understand how you are currently using the ground and learn the concept of optimal force production to maximize efficiency and distance. We look at magnitude direction and timing of forces in all 3 dimensions and discuss drills you can use to improve all three. We also look at the timing and velocity of you hips, torso, arms, and club to optimize swing efficiency and consistent contact.

Movement Analysis Session
By looking at the way your body moves to determine which swing faults you’re likely experiencing and whether your body is capable of creating a pain-free and consistent swing. After combining a global Functional Movement Screen and the golf-specific TPI Screen, we’ll develop a strategy to improve your mobility, stability, strength, and power so you can create a smooth and efficient swing.

Skokie Sports Park's indoor Trackman golf simulator, The Bunker, is now open!

Available for up to 4 people at a time, improve your game on the virtual driving range with an amazing array of statistics, play any one of over 200 courses around the world, or try one of the many fun games available.
